Teachers' RightsCalled to a Meeting If you are called into a meeting with an administrator which you think may result in accusatory proceedings, be certain to have a Building Rep present. Meeting Goes to Haywire If you find yourself in a meeting which you did not expect to be accusatory, but which results in accusations against you , ask for an adjournment of the meeting, make NO COMMENTS on the issue at hand, and immediately consult with your Building Rep to discuss the steps you should take. Oops! Forgot My Rep If you are in a meeting, without a Building Rep, and you are unable to stop the meeting for any reason, discontinue participation in the meeting, take notes, do not respond or react and at the end of the meeting SEE YOUR BUILDING REP. Want to Leave A Meeting If you are so uncomfortable with an administrator that it would be impossible to have any kind of meeting without a Building Rep be sure to inform your Rep of this so that they may insure their presence at any meeting you may be called into. 1. Report the incident immediately to your administrator & call CUEA Rep.2. See the nurse. The incident must be documented by the nurse. The document may later be needed for any type of testimony.3. Be calm and give yourself time away from the confusion before making any comments to ANYONE. All statements will be used FOR OR AGAINST YOU.4. In case of assault file serious incident report with help of Building Rep. 5. An accident report must be filled out and signed. If you are unable to sign the form SEE YOUR BUILDING REP.6. You, the nurse or administrator must notify the administration building. This will enable a quick referral to a physician.7. Read the Health Care providers and select one. If the provider you selected is not immediately avail able, see the one that is, this will avoid further deterioration of your condition.8. The provider must be seen by you for a minimum of 30 days. If at the end of the 30 days you are not satisfied inform the district that you will be seeing your own doctor and the provider.9. Denial in any of the above contact CUEA and/or PSEA.10. DO NOT WRITE OR SIGN ANY STATEMENTS. Contact your Building Rep or PSEA.11. Do not attend any meetings with- out representation.
As a professional educator, you must keep a file that will be easily available with the following documents: •Certificate(s) •All professional ratings •CUEA contract •Letter of Appointment •Record of appointment in the school board minutes •Copies of teaching schedules, including the number of students in each class for the current and past years •Record of accumulated sick and personal days •Yearly salary (provided yearly by the district •Transcripts of undergraduate and graduate credits •Degrees •Records of retirement •Records of commendations, awards, honors, etc. •Records of disciplinary referrals of students and methods used in handling specific classroom problems. •Records of all students referred for teaming and the follow-up •Review your personnel file yearly
